A longitudinal movement of a vehicle is automatically regulated by detecting, using recorded signals of an environment sensor system an environment of the vehicle and objects located. A state of a traffic light system to be accounted for by the vehicle at a traffic light signal controlled junction in order for the vehicle to pass through the junction is determined. When the vehicle approaches the junction, it is recognized that a view of the environment sensor system of the traffic light system may be obscured by a vehicle in front, then a minimum distance of the vehicle to the vehicle in front is determined depending on a current position of the vehicle in relation to the traffic light system and in relation to the vehicle in front, which minimum distance is used as the basis of the automatic regulation of the longitudinal movement and is not undershot by the vehicle.
